Hey guys,

Computer question. I have a bunch of AVI videos that i want to burn onto a VCD. I have Ulead Video Studio because i could get it for free for 30 days. It will burn MPEGs fine, but it seems to have a problem with AVIs. Do you guys know of any program that can burn AVIs to VCD so i can play them in my DVD player? Thanks [img]smile.gif[/img]

Ehh nevermind guys. I did some research and found out that it doesn't matter how big the files are, its their length. I was trying to burn more than 80 minutes to a VCD and i thought that because the total file size was about 630MB, it would all fit on 1 CD but it will take 3 because the total duration is 2:34.
